In every wardrobe there is a quiet potential waiting to be unlocked, a possibility to assemble fresh ensembles from established pieces rather than chasing the next seasonal trend. Start by surveying what you own with calm intention, separating items you truly wear from ones that no longer fit your current style. Consider the core color family you naturally lean toward and note fabrics that unify outfits, such as monochrome bases or subtle textures. This foundational review is not about cataloging every item but about discovering the connective threads that tie your clothes together. When you can see the relationships between pieces, you’ll begin to recognize countless pairing options without bringing new items into the mix.
A practical way to build cohesive outfits is to map your pieces to a small set of reliable silhouettes. Choose three or four go-to shapes—say, a relaxed trouser, a structured blazer, a knit top, and a versatile dress—that work with most of your wardrobe. Then test each item against those shapes, asking whether it complements the common color palette and whether the fabric sits well in different contexts, from work to weekends. When an item doesn’t align with at least two silhouettes, consider letting it go or repurposing it through alteration. The goal is to establish a handful of strong, adaptable base items that can be combined with lesser-used pieces for varied looks.

For many people, color is the quickest route to cohesion, but it must be handled with nuance. Start by selecting two or three anchor colors that appear frequently in your existing wardrobe, then build neutrals around them so you can mix and match confidently. Neutrals such as black, ivory, taupe, or navy act as reliable canvases for bolder accents. When you feel unsure, try creating outfits in head-to-toe shades within the same tonal range or layer a single bright accent over a calm base to elevate the ensemble. The objective is to create harmony that feels effortless, not calculated, so your outfits radiate confidence in everyday moments.

Texture and proportion are often overlooked in closet planning, yet they can dramatically change how an outfit reads. Pairing textiles with similar weight and drape helps garments sit smoothly against each other, preventing bulky or flimsy combinations. If you own a heavy wool coat, balance it with lighter knits and sleek trousers rather than multiple stiff layers. Proportions also matter: if a top is oversized, offset it with a fitted bottom, and vice versa. Small tweaks like tucking a shirt, choosing slightly shorter hems, or adjusting sleeve lengths can transform an ordinary pairing into something polished and intentional, without shopping.

One of the most empowering habits is a deliberate wardrobe calendar that tracks how you actually wear items. At the end of each month, note which pieces were favorites, which were rarely worn, and which combinations sparked confidence. Use this record to guide future choices and to plan your days around your existing inventory. Rather than purchasing impulsively, challenge yourself to create new looks with items you already own. You can experiment by swapping accessories, changing footwear, or layering layers in unexpected ways. The goal is to cultivate a practical, evolving system that honors your personal style while resisting compulsive shopping.

Accessories can dramatically alter a single garment’s character without requiring a new buy. A scarf, belt, hat, or pair of earrings can push a neutral outfit into a different mood, suitable for work, date nights, or casual weekends. When selecting accessories, pick a cohesive set that reflects your color story and texture palette. Rotate pieces regularly to discover fresh combinations, and store items in a way that makes them easy to locate. Thoughtful accessory planning turns a handful of staples into numerous, distinct outfits, extending the life and relevance of what already exists in your closet.

Layering is a powerful tool for achieving cohesion across seasons, especially when you’re relying on existing items. A lightweight cardigan under a blazer, a moto jacket over a silk blouse, or a simple tee beneath a dress can create depth and adaptability. Think in terms of layers that can be added or removed to adjust an ensemble’s formality or warmth. Layer combinations also offer opportunities to reveal or conceal textures, colors, and lines, which keeps your wardrobe feeling new. By practicing thoughtful layering, you’ll extend the utility of your current clothes and enjoy more outfit variation with minimal effort.
Another essential approach is rethinking the role of each garment within your wardrobe story. Instead of labeling pieces as “best” or “worst,” assess what function they truly serve, whether it’s core workwear, casual weekend wear, or special occasions. A tank top can become a base layer for chilly evenings; a short dress can transform into a tunic with leggings; a blazer can be dressed down with a knit dress. This reframing encourages creativity, reduces waste, and helps you see hidden potential in seemingly ordinary garments, reinforcing a sustainable mindset while keeping style fresh.

Wardrobe planning thrives on disciplined capsule-style thinking, even when your closet isn’t perfectly minimal. Start by selecting a few essential neutrals and a small color accent you love. Then assemble a cohesive mix of tops, bottoms, and outerwear that can be interchanged across many outfits. The strength of a capsule lies in repeatable pairings, so document a few reliable combinations and try them again in different contexts. When you resist the urge to overstuff the closet, you give yourself space to experiment with confidence. Over time, this system becomes second nature, guiding what to keep, what to repair, and what to let go.
The maintenance phase of wardrobe planning is crucial. Regularly assess fit, fabric condition, and color consistency to prevent a mismatch of items that can derail outfits. Schedule concise wardrobe refreshes every season to address issues such as shrinking hems or faded dyes. Small repairs and tailoring can make a big difference in how pieces sit and feel. A well-maintained closet reduces decision fatigue, saves money, and makes it easier to assemble cohesive looks from what you already own, reinforcing a durable personal style.
Beyond the practicalities, emotional attachment to certain pieces can both help and hinder your wardrobe cohesion. It’s natural to feel a rush of nostalgia for a beloved jacket or dress, but attachment should not override function. Practice a balanced approach: celebrate what you love while acknowledging when a garment no longer serves you well. If a favorite item no longer aligns with your current color story or silhouette, consider repurposing it into a new accessory or donating it to someone who will appreciate it. By consciously managing emotional ties, you keep your closet vibrant and flexible, making space for pieces that truly reflect who you are today.
Finally, set a personal standard for shopping that aligns with your goals of cohesion and longevity. Before purchasing, pause to ask whether the item will integrate with at least three current pieces, whether it fills a missing role, or whether it enhances your established color and texture palette. If the answer is uncertain, wait a few weeks and re-evaluate. This mindful approach reduces waste, preserves your existing investments, and ensures every new addition contributes meaningfully to your cohesive wardrobe. Over time, you’ll build a closet that feels timeless, inclusive, and thoughtfully curated.
